Summary: The application filed by plaintiff Muhammad Rafeeq Karorath under Order 13 Rule 9 CPC to return the original Sale Deed No. 1701 of 2023 (subject matter of the case) and replace it with a certified copy has been dismissed. The court rejected the petitioner's claim that the original deed was needed urgently for the Village Office, noting that the deed is a crucial material object in ongoing criminal case Crime No. 608 of 2023 (involving allegations of forgery under IPC Sections 463, 465, 468, 471, 420, and 34), and granting the request would be inappropriate given the pending criminal investigation.
